Signs you need HVAC mold cleaning
- A musty or 'wet dog' smell when the HVAC system kicks on
- Visible mold or discolouration around a vent, air handler closet, or condensate line
- Water staining or dampness in a master-bath air handler closet
- Allergy-type symptoms that worsen specifically when the AC is running
- Recurring condensate line clogs or overflow
How we handle HVAC mold cleaning in Hackensack
Standard duct cleaning and HVAC mold remediation are not the same service, and the distinction matters. If mold is confirmed inside ductwork or on an air handler coil, that's a mold remediation scope under S520 — assessment, containment appropriate to the space, and treatment of the affected components — not a routine duct-cleaning appointment.
